These marine bivalves (clams) are found in Cretaceous deposits that span Southern Australia. From the world famous mining region and town, Coober Pedy, these fossil clam shells have been entirely replaced by precious opal.
The clams belong to the genus Cyrenopsis (either C. australiensis or C. meeki)
